Design and Size

When it comes to design and size, the Hamilton Beach 5 Cup Drip Coffee Maker is compact and ideal for small kitchens, while the BLACK+DECKER 12-Cup Digital Coffee Maker offers a larger capacity. The Hamilton Beach model features a space-saving design that easily fits under kitchen cabinets, making it suitable for apartments or kitchens with limited counter space. In contrast, the BLACK+DECKER model boasts a 12-cup capacity, making it a better option for those who brew coffee for multiple people or enjoy having coffee on hand throughout the day.

Brewing Capacity

The brewing capacity is where the BLACK+DECKER 12-Cup Digital Coffee Maker shines with its ability to brew up to 12 cups at a time. This is significantly more than the Hamilton Beach model, which brews only 5 cups. The BLACK+DECKER is perfect for households that consume a lot of coffee or for entertaining guests, as it reduces the need for multiple brewing cycles. Meanwhile, the Hamilton Beach coffee maker is designed for individuals or smaller households, minimizing coffee waste and ensuring that users only brew what they need.

Ease of Use

Ease of use is a standout feature of both coffee makers, but they cater to different preferences. The BLACK+DECKER 12-Cup model offers QuickTouch programming buttons that allow users to set the 24-hour auto brew feature easily. This means you can wake up to a fresh pot of coffee without any hassle. The Hamilton Beach model features a FrontFill water reservoir and swing-out brew basket, which simplifies the process of adding water and coffee grounds. This design minimizes spills and makes the machine easy to operate, especially in tight spaces.

Programmability

Both coffee makers come with programmable features, but there are differences in their functionalities. The BLACK+DECKER 12-Cup Digital Coffee Maker allows users to program the machine up to 24 hours in advance, ensuring coffee is ready when you wake up. In addition, it has a digital display that shows the clock and brew time. The Hamilton Beach model also offers a 24-hour programming feature but focuses more on easy access with its user-friendly design. This makes it simple to set up the coffee maker ahead of time, ensuring that hot coffee is ready when desired.

Performance and Features

Performance-wise, the BLACK+DECKER 12-Cup Digital Coffee Maker stands out with its Sneak-A-Cup feature, which allows users to pour a cup of coffee before brewing has finished, preventing messes. Additionally, it has a Keep Hot Plate that ensures coffee stays warm after brewing. The Hamilton Beach model also includes an auto-pause and pour feature, allowing users to serve coffee before the brewing cycle is complete. While both machines perform well, the BLACK+DECKER offers more advanced features for coffee lovers who appreciate a seamless brewing experience.

Maintenance and Cleaning

Both coffee makers have features that facilitate maintenance and cleaning, but they cater to different user needs. The BLACK+DECKER 12-Cup Digital Coffee Maker comes equipped with a washable brew basket, which helps reduce the need for disposable filters and makes cleaning easier. In contrast, the Hamilton Beach model’s compact design allows for easy access to the brew basket and water reservoir, making it simple to clean without much hassle. The choice between the two may depend on whether users prefer a larger machine that requires a bit more space or a compact unit that’s easy to maintain.
